This report proposes a new independent regulatory body for Indonesias Electricity sector, in particular for investment planning, procurement, tariff setting, and electrification.
It provides guidance on how an effective regulatory body.
The report explains the current context and issues in operations and processes.
A situational analysis and review of stakeholder opinions strongly indicates that the current decision-making structures in the Electricity Sector of Indonesia are inadequate.
